К олимпиадам

Шаг первый — изучение языков

Введение в программирование (C++)

Основы разработки на C++: белый пояс

Шаг второй — решение базового набора задач


Язык программирования C++
Решение олимпиадных задач


Задачи из учебника К.Ю. Полякова и Е.А. Еремина
Е. В. Андреева. Программирование — это так просто, программирование — это так сложно.

Шаг третий — тренировка

Личные олимпиады
Региональные олимпиады
Архив задач

Шаг четвёртый — соревнования

Codeforces
Перечень олимпиад